Skip to product information
1 of 3

Nature's Answer

Nature's Answer - Valerian Root - 1 Fl Oz

Nature's Answer - Valerian Root - 1 Fl Oz

Regular price $12.99 USD
Regular price Sale price $12.99 USD
Sale Sold out
Nature's answer - valerian root - 1 fl oz
country of origin : united states
is kosher : yes
size : 1 fz
pack of : 1
selling unit : each
ingredients : purified water;vegetable glycerin;12-15% certified organic alcohol
View full details